Abstract

The utility model discloses a head fixing frame for neurosurgery, which comprises a bottom plate, a supporting rod and a supporting plate, wherein the bottom of the bottom plate is provided with a supporting roller; the support rod is fixed in the middle of the bottom plate and comprises a lower support rod, an adjusting rod and an upper support rod from bottom to top, the lower support rod and the upper support rod are L-shaped, the length of the adjusting rod is adjustable, and the lower support rod, the adjusting rod and the upper support rod are connected into a bow shape; the top of the upper supporting rod is connected with a spherical hinge, the top of the spherical hinge is connected with a supporting plate, and the supporting plate is arc-shaped; one end of the supporting plate is fixedly connected with an elastic band, and the head end of the elastic band is detachably connected with the other end of the supporting plate.

Background
Neurosurgery is mainly used for treating diseases of nervous systems of brain, spinal cord and the like caused by trauma, such as life threatening due to cerebral hemorrhage and bleeding amount, brain trauma caused by car accidents, or operation treatment required by brain tumor compression. The cranial nerve operation is the operation with the highest risk, when the cranial nerve operation is performed, a doctor needs to concentrate attention highly and need to perform the operation with great care, however, because the body position of a patient moves or the head is not fixed, the operation risk is easy to increase, the operation manufacturing difficulty for the doctor is difficult, and the supporting position and the height of the position of the existing device for supporting the head of a human body are inconvenient to adjust at any time, so that the requirements of various operations cannot be met.
In addition, when the head of the patient is mounted with the head frame, the head needs to extend to the outer side of the operating table, and a doctor needs to hold the head of the patient with hands, lift the head of the patient and mount the head frame. Because the installation headstock is consuming time longer, so greatly increased hug the doctor's of embracing patient's head physical demands, and greatly increased the risk that the landing of installation headstock in-process patient's head caused head and cervical vertebra to damage, so and then greatly increased the operation degree of difficulty, risk and burden.

Detailed Description
The present invention will be further explained with reference to the accompanying drawings:
as shown in fig. 1, a head fixing frame for neurosurgery comprises a bottom plate 1, a support rod and a support supporting plate 9, wherein a support roller 2 is arranged at the bottom of the bottom plate 1. The supporting roller 2 is of a universal wheel structure, the braking assembly is arranged on the supporting roller 2, and the supporting roller 2 can be fixed by pressing the braking assembly.
The bracing piece is fixed in the middle part of bottom plate 1, and the bracing piece from bottom to top includes bottom suspension strut 3, adjusts pole and last bracing piece 7, and bottom suspension strut 3 and last bracing piece 7 are L shape, and the length of adjusting rod is adjustable, and bottom suspension strut 3, adjust the pole and go up bracing piece 7 and connect into bow-shaped. The adjusting rod comprises an upper vertical screw rod 5, a lower vertical screw rod 4 and an adjusting sleeve 6, the upper screw rod 5 is fixedly connected with the head end of an upper supporting rod 7, the lower vertical screw rod 4 is fixedly connected with the head end of a lower supporting rod 3, and the upper vertical screw rod 5 and the lower vertical screw rod 4 are oppositely arranged; be equipped with clockwise external screw thread on the upper screw rod 5, be equipped with anticlockwise external screw thread on the lower screw rod 4, the both ends of adjusting sleeve 6 are equipped with clockwise internal thread and anticlockwise internal thread respectively, and 6 both ends of adjusting sleeve respectively with upper screw rod 5 and 4 threaded connection of lower screw rod.
The top of going up bracing piece 7 is connected with ball pivot 8, and support layer board 9 is connected at the top of ball pivot 8, and support layer board 9 is the arc, has laid flexible material on the upper surface of support layer board 9. One end of the supporting plate 9 is fixedly connected with an elastic band 10, and the head end of the elastic band 10 is connected with the other end of the supporting plate 9 through a magic tape or a buckle. The utility model discloses damping formula ball pivot structure is selected for use to ball pivot 8, and ball pivot 8 rotating resistance is great, is convenient for support.
The utility model discloses a use method as follows:
when the device is used, the device is moved to the head end of an operating table, the height of the adjusting rod is adjusted according to the height of the operating table, and when the head of a patient is placed on the supporting plate 9, the head is slightly higher than the body. The support rod is in a bow shape and mainly has the function of reserving space for the installation of the headstock until the installation of the headstock is influenced. The bottom of the supporting plate 9 is connected with a spherical hinge 8, and the head of a patient can rotate at a small angle on the head frame, so that the head frame is convenient to mount.
